Output 2325fae528dc75924f32b602c193a2868c74241966e6cd620c7c1eb4b8e1d80f:4

value
6500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20f52dc0bc98dd093b82194699741370b3fdbc0a OP_EQUAL
address
34hHFzsXD1obwkzuu7ZBGd4kuNdgatrtYg
transaction
2325fae528dc75924f32b602c193a2868c74241966e6cd620c7c1eb4b8e1d80f
spent
true